Unverified Commit 79ec38f7 authored by Jonah Williams's avatar Jonah Williams Committed by GitHub

ensure we use pub from flutter sdk (#40131)

parent 2449928d
...@@ -21,6 +21,7 @@ import '../base/platform.dart'; ...@@ -21,6 +21,7 @@ import '../base/platform.dart';
import '../base/process_manager.dart'; import '../base/process_manager.dart';
import '../codegen.dart'; import '../codegen.dart';
import '../dart/pub.dart'; import '../dart/pub.dart';
import '../dart/sdk.dart';
import '../globals.dart'; import '../globals.dart';
import '../project.dart'; import '../project.dart';
...@@ -112,7 +113,7 @@ class BuildRunner extends CodeGenerator { ...@@ -112,7 +113,7 @@ class BuildRunner extends CodeGenerator {
} }
scriptIdFile.writeAsBytesSync(appliedBuilderDigest); scriptIdFile.writeAsBytesSync(appliedBuilderDigest);
final ProcessResult generateResult = await processManager.run(<String>[ final ProcessResult generateResult = await processManager.run(<String>[
'pub', 'run', 'build_runner', 'generate-build-script' sdkBinaryName('pub'), 'run', 'build_runner', 'generate-build-script'
], workingDirectory: syntheticPubspec.parent.path); ], workingDirectory: syntheticPubspec.parent.path);
if (generateResult.exitCode != 0) { if (generateResult.exitCode != 0) {
throwToolExit('Error generating build_script snapshot: ${generateResult.stderr}'); throwToolExit('Error generating build_script snapshot: ${generateResult.stderr}');
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ment